Investment thesis
ZEA invests in dual-use technology companies developing mission-critical innovations across artificial intelligence, robotics, space, manufacturing, and microelectronics. The firm targets companies with 20-1,000 employees that prioritize security, scalability, and mission-driven growth. ZEA provides comprehensive support including capital deployment, board representation, regulatory navigation, government connections, and strategic guidance to help founders bridge defense and commercial markets.

Falcomm is a fabless semiconductor company that designs and manufactures power amplifier components for satellite communications, telecom, defense, and consumer markets. The company specializes in radio frequency (RF) integrated circuits with patented Dual-Drive technology that delivers higher efficiency, greater output power, and reduced heat dissipation.
